Men's Soccer Races to 5-1 USA South Semifinal Win Over Averett
Bookmark and Share
  MARTINSVILLE, Va. - The fifth-ranked CNU men's soccer team earned a spot in the USA South championship game with a 5-1 win over Averett Friday. 
  The Captains had a 2-1 halftime lead but then controlled the second half for the win that put them in the title game.
  Brian Lybert scored first for CNU in the 18th minute with an assist to Trevor Moyer, but Samuli Markkanen evened the score for Averett in the 26th minute.
  Nao Masuda scored the first of his two goals barely two minutes later, with an assist from Lybert, which put CNU ahead to stay.
  Masuda added his second, again from Lybert, just 51 seconds after halftime and then assisted on a goal by Joseph O'Connell, along with John Corser, in the 80th minute.
  Michael Zimmerman completed the scoring in the 86th minute with an assist to Andrew Bonorden.
  The win puts CNU, now 17-2, in the 5:00 championship game against N.C. Wesleyan Saturday.
